Did you know fall in Portland is the best time to plant new trees? Portland Parks and Recreation’s Urban Forestry Team is making it easier than ever to add some foliage to your yard by giving away thousands of free trees to Portlanders.
Adding trees to your yard can offer shade, boost pollinator and animal habitat and enhance your yard’s beauty.

Sign Up for Portland’s Free Yard Tree Giveaway
Choose from a variety of medium to large trees, including native, evergreen, conifer and deciduous options. There’s large native evergreens, heat-tolerant trees for hotter summers, flowering trees, nut-bearing and trees rich with autumn color. Best of all, you get to choose what you want.
Every fall, Portland residents can sign up to receive up to three free yard trees to plant at:
- Your home
- A place of worship
- A business property
You can also choose from a variety of delivery options, including home delivery and professional planting by the Urban Forestry team.
To participate, the trees must follow these guidelines:
- Planted within Portland city limits in your front, side or back yard. Trees cannot be planted in the space between sidewalk and curb.
- You agree to let Urban Forestry check on your tree during summer as part of a study.

Trees are available on a first come, first served basis and typically are gone by mid-December.
